ssm

基于SSM的RBAC权限系统(1)-利用ajax,bootstrap,ztree完成权限树功能

随声附和 提交于 2019-11-27 02:51:05
仅支持回显以及选择,不支持在树中的编辑 搭建后台回显以及修改的模块 JSON数据封装 public class Msg { private int code; private String msg; private Map<String,Object> extend=new HashMap<String,Object>(); //还有一些getset方法没显示出来 public static Msg success(){ Msg result = new Msg(); result.setCode(100); result.setMsg("处理成功"); return result; } public static Msg fail(){ Msg result = new Msg(); result.setCode(200); result.setMsg("处理失败"); return result; } public static Msg noPermission(){ Msg result = new Msg(); result.setCode(250); result.setMsg("没有权限"); return result; } public static Msg reject(){ Msg result = new Msg(); result.setCode(300);

SSM整合

一世执手 提交于 2019-11-27 02:49:17
SSM环境搭建 环境:IDEA+Maven 1. 创建web项目 2. 构建项目目录结构 原始的目录结构为如下 修改后如下 注意: java:里面放的是编写的java代码,要把目录标记为Source Root resources:里面存放的是一些配置文件,要把目录标记为Resources Root statics:里面存放一些静态资源文件css、js pages:里面存放html或者jsp等页面 3. pom.xml导入相关的依赖 <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"> <modelVersion>4.0.0</modelVersion> <groupId>org.gpnu</groupId> <artifactId>ssmdemo</artifactId> <version>1.0-SNAPSHOT</version> <packaging

ssm的一些概念

旧城冷巷雨未停 提交于 2019-11-27 02:26:18
xml Extensible Markup Language 可扩展标记语言,标准通用标记语言的子集,简称XML。是一种用于标记电子文件使其具有结构性的标记语言。 dtd DTD为英文Document Type Definition,中文意思为“文档类定义”可定义合法的XML文档构建模块。它使用一系列合法的元素来定义文档的结构。 DTD 可被成行地声明于 XML 文档中,也可作为一个外部引用。 junite xUnit是一套基于测试驱动开发的测试框架 其中的断言机制:将程序预期的结果与程序运行的最终结果进行比对,确保对结果的可预知性 要求 1.测试方法上必须使用@Test 2.测试方法必须使用 public void进行修饰 3.新建一个源代码目录来存放测试代码 4.测试类的包应该和被测试类的包一样 5.测试单元中的每个方法一定要能够独立测试,其方法不能有任何依赖 mapper MyBatis 通用 Mapper 是一个可以让开发人员更方便使用 MyBatis 的扩展, 通过简单的配置,可以方便的直接获取单表的常见操作,提供如 select, selectAll, selectCount, delete, update 以及 Example 相关的方法。 开发人员不需要编写SQL,不需要在DAO中增加方法,只要写好实体类,就能支持相应的增删改查方法。 MyBatis 是支持普通

ssm异常处理原理图及实现方法

蓝咒 提交于 2019-11-27 01:16:44
1.使用异常处理器捕获运行时异常; 第一步:创建包实现HandlerExceptionResolver接口 第二步:在applicationContext.xml中配置异常处理器 第三部:处理异常信息 //obj 代表异常对象的 全包名 + 类名 + 方法名 ——————————————————————————————— 1.使用异常处理器捕获自定义异常; 第一步:创建异常类继承Exception 第二步:在applicationContext.xml中配置异常处理器 第三部:在自定义异常处理器实现类中增加判断方法 —————————————————————————————— 1.通过注解完成全局异常处理; 第一步:创建异常类继承Exception 第二部:创建自定义全局异常处理类 来源: CSDN 作者: weixin_45924969 链接: https://blog.csdn.net/weixin_45924969/article/details/103240850

基于SSM的医院预约挂号系统设计与实现

你。 提交于 2019-11-26 21:35:16
基于SSM的医院预约挂号系统设计与实现 基于SSM的医院预约挂号系统设计与实现mysql数据库创建语句 基于SSM的医院预约挂号系统设计与实现oracle数据库创建语句 基于SSM的医院预约挂号系统设计与实现sqlserver数据库创建语句 基于SSM的医院预约挂号系统设计与实现spring springMVC hibernate框架对象(javaBean,pojo)设计 基于SSM的医院预约挂号系统设计与实现spring springMVC mybatis框架对象(javaBean,pojo)设计 基于SSM的医院预约挂号系统设计与实现mysql数据库版本源码: 超级管理员表创建语句如下: create table t_admin( id int primary key auto_increment comment '主键', username varchar(100) comment '超级管理员账号', password varchar(100) comment '超级管理员密码' ) comment '超级管理员'; insert into t_admin(username,password) values('admin','123456'); 建议表创建语句如下: create table t_contact( id int primary key auto

基于SSM框架的教务系统

你说的曾经没有我的故事 提交于 2019-11-26 21:34:49
简介 这是个基于SSM+Bootstrap的教务查询系统,是一个简单的教务查询系统. 做了关于数据库的增删改查练习。 用来熟悉SSM的整合开发。 技术 IOC容器:Spring Web框架:SpringMVC ORM框架:Mybatis 数据源:C3P0 日志:log4j 前端框架:Bootstrap 环境 运行环境 jdk8+tomcat8+mysql+ Eclipse +maven(jdk7,tomcat7也支持) 项目技术: spring+spring mvc+mybatis+bootstrap+jquery 管理员模块 管理员可对 教师信息、学生信息、课程信息 进行 增删改查 操作,管理员账户,可以重置非管理员账户的密码 * 课程管理:当课程已经有学生选课成功时,将不能删除 * 学生管理:添加学生信息时,其信息也会添加到登录表中 * 教师管理:同上 * 账户密码重置: * 修改密码: 教师模块 教师登陆后,可以获取其,教授的课程列表,并可以给已经选择该课程的同学打分,无法对已经给完分的同学进行二次操作 * 我的课程 * 修改密码 学生模块 学生登录后,根据学生信息,获取其已经选择的课程,和已经修完的课程 * 所有课程: 在这里选修课程,选好后,将会自动跳转到已选课程选项 * 已选课程: 这里显示的是,还没修完的课程,也就是老师还没给成绩,由于还没有给成绩

基于SSM的网上求职报名系统设计和实现

◇◆丶佛笑我妖孽 提交于 2019-11-26 21:34:23
基于SSM的网上求职报名系统设计和实现 基于SSM的网上求职报名系统设计和实现mysql数据库创建语句 基于SSM的网上求职报名系统设计和实现oracle数据库创建语句 基于SSM的网上求职报名系统设计和实现sqlserver数据库创建语句 基于SSM的网上求职报名系统设计和实现spring springMVC hibernate框架对象(javaBean,pojo)设计 基于SSM的网上求职报名系统设计和实现spring springMVC mybatis框架对象(javaBean,pojo)设计 基于SSM的网上求职报名系统设计和实现mysql数据库版本源码: 超级管理员表创建语句如下: create table t_admin( id int primary key auto_increment comment '主键', username varchar(100) comment '超级管理员账号', password varchar(100) comment '超级管理员密码' ) comment '超级管理员'; insert into t_admin(username,password) values('admin','123456'); 表创建语句如下: create table t_customer( id int primary key auto

基于SSM的宿舍管理系统的设计与实现

无人久伴 提交于 2019-11-26 21:32:57
基于SSM的宿舍管理系统的设计与实现 基于SSM的宿舍管理系统的设计与实现mysql数据库创建语句 基于SSM的宿舍管理系统的设计与实现oracle数据库创建语句 基于SSM的宿舍管理系统的设计与实现sqlserver数据库创建语句 基于SSM的宿舍管理系统的设计与实现spring springMVC hibernate框架对象(javaBean,pojo)设计 基于SSM的宿舍管理系统的设计与实现spring springMVC mybatis框架对象(javaBean,pojo)设计 基于SSM的宿舍管理系统的设计与实现mysql数据库版本源码: 超级管理员表创建语句如下: create table t_admin( id int primary key auto_increment comment '主键', username varchar(100) comment '超级管理员账号', password varchar(100) comment '超级管理员密码' ) comment '超级管理员'; insert into t_admin(username,password) values('admin','123456'); 班级表创建语句如下: create table t_bj( id int primary key auto_increment comment

基于SSM的专利分析系统,基于java的毕业设计

生来就可爱ヽ(ⅴ<●) 提交于 2019-11-26 21:32:26
**基于SSM的专利分析系统,基于java的毕业设计** 基于SSM的专利分析系统mysql数据库创建语句 基于SSM的专利分析系统oracle数据库创建语句 基于SSM的专利分析系统sqlserver数据库创建语句 基于SSM的专利分析系统spring springMVC hibernate框架对象(javaBean,pojo)设计 基于SSM的专利分析系统spring springMVC mybatis框架对象(javaBean,pojo)设计 基于SSM的专利分析系统mysql数据库版本源码: 超级管理员表创建语句如下: create table t_admin( id int primary key auto_increment comment '主键', username varchar(100) comment '超级管理员账号', password varchar(100) comment '超级管理员密码' ) comment '超级管理员'; insert into t_admin(username,password) values('admin','123456'); 分类表创建语句如下: create table t_bk( id int primary key auto_increment comment '主键', bkName varchar(100)

基于SSM网上在线批改系统

不想你离开。 提交于 2019-11-26 21:30:25
基于SSM网上在线批改系统 基于SSM网上在线批改系统mysql数据库创建语句 基于SSM网上在线批改系统oracle数据库创建语句 基于SSM网上在线批改系统sqlserver数据库创建语句 基于SSM网上在线批改系统spring springMVC hibernate框架对象(javaBean,pojo)设计 基于SSM网上在线批改系统spring springMVC mybatis框架对象(javaBean,pojo)设计 基于SSM网上在线批改系统mysql数据库版本源码: 超级管理员表创建语句如下: create table t_admin( id int primary key auto_increment comment '主键', username varchar(100) comment '超级管理员账号', password varchar(100) comment '超级管理员密码' ) comment '超级管理员'; insert into t_admin(username,password) values('admin','123456'); 班级表创建语句如下: create table t_bj( id int primary key auto_increment comment '主键', bjName varchar(100) comment